When a drawing shape is inserted to a change tracked Writer document, there is
no change tracking entry created.
This would be a nice to have feature from interoperability point of view.

Steps to reproduce:
    1. Open attached document. It has change tracking enabled and has a shape
anchored to the first paragraph.
    2. Insert – Shape – Insert any shape
    3. Edit – Track Changes – Manage

Actual results:
The shape insertion has not created a change tracking entry

Expected results:
The insertion of a shape should be change tracked.
